1989 Ford Mustang LX Notchback: Canadian Muscle Reborn

1989 Ford Mustang LX Notchback

The 1989 Ford Mustang LX Notchback has long been a staple of Canadian muscle car culture. This example, acquired by its current owner in 2024, comes with extensive upgrades that transform it into a modern, drivable classic. Finished in black over black cloth, it carries the presence of an original Mustang with the performance punch of a tuned V8.

Exterior & Styling

The car features a DECH-style lower aero package and an aftermarket grille. Dual side mirrors, dual exhaust outlets, and gold-finished 17″ SVE mesh alloy wheels complement its aggressive stance. Photos reveal some trunk holes from a removed spoiler and minor paint blemishes, while the side mirrors are powered but disconnected.

Interior Features

Inside, the Flo-Fit sport seats and rear bench were retrimmed in black during the 1990s. Comforts include a cabin heater, power windows, and a Pioneer touchscreen infotainment system linked to a custom audio setup. The two-spoke steering wheel frames a column-mounted shift light and a 200-km/h speedometer, alongside a tachometer and additional gauges for oil pressure, boost, and coolant temperature.

Engine & Performance

At the heart of this Mustang is a supercharged 302ci V8 rebuilt in 2024 by Paul Silva Performance. Modifications include an AMS A4 block with four-bolt mains, polished air intake and intake manifold, a Vortech centrifugal supercharger, Accufab 75mm throttle body, revised fuel system, custom dual exhaust, MSD TFI ignition, and air conditioning delete. The T5Z five-speed manual and limited-slip differential deliver raw power to the rear wheels.

Suspension & Brakes

This notchback rides on a lowered suspension with front disc brakes and rear drums. Falken Azenis FR510 tires grip the 17″ wheels, providing both style and performance. The setup balances vintage handling cues with modern stability.

Ownership & Documentation

The Mustang shows 75,000 kilometers (~46,000 miles), with about 3,000 km added under the current ownership. The US Carfax is free of accidents but notes a mileage inconsistency in 2006 and potential odometer rollover in 2011. No title exists, as Ontario does not issue vehicle titles, but the car comes with transferable registration, service records, spare parts, and a car cover.
